The Physiological Factors Behind Changing Nutritional Needs
As the body progresses through life, a series of physiological changes impact how it processes food and utilizes nutrients. These shifts are not a sign of decline but a natural part of the aging process that requires dietary adaptation for sustained health. The change in metabolism is one of the most significant factors; as we get older, our basal metabolic rate (BMR) slows down. This means the body requires fewer calories to maintain its weight, a phenomenon tied to a natural reduction in physical activity and a decrease in lean muscle mass. The average adult can lose 3–8% of their muscle mass each decade after age 30, a condition known as sarcopenia.
Decreased Nutrient Absorption
Another critical factor is the body’s reduced ability to absorb and utilize certain nutrients. For example, low stomach acid, a common issue in older adults, can impair the absorption of crucial nutrients like vitamin B12, calcium, iron, and magnesium. The kidneys and liver also become less efficient with age, further affecting the absorption and metabolism of vitamins like B12 and D. This creates a nutritional dilemma: older adults need fewer calories but often require higher amounts of specific nutrients to counteract these absorption issues.
Sensory Changes and Appetite
Changes in taste and smell are also common with age and can have a significant impact on diet. Food may become less appealing, leading to a reduced appetite and less varied food choices. This, in turn, increases the risk of nutrient deficiencies. The body's ability to recognize hunger and thirst can also diminish, making older adults more susceptible to dehydration. The “anorexia of aging” is a term used to describe this reduced appetite and energy intake, which can lead to unintentional weight loss and poor health.
Adapting to Evolving Nutritional Requirements
Understanding these changes is key to developing a dietary strategy that supports healthy aging. The focus must shift from a calorie-heavy diet to one that is nutrient-dense, emphasizing quality over quantity.
Important Nutrients for Older Adults
Here is a list of key nutrients that become increasingly important with age:
- Protein: Essential for maintaining muscle mass and fighting sarcopenia. Excellent sources include lean meats, fish, eggs, dairy, beans, and lentils.
- Calcium and Vitamin D: Crucial for bone health and preventing osteoporosis. As the skin becomes less efficient at producing vitamin D, dietary intake and supplementation become more vital.
- Vitamin B12: Due to reduced stomach acid, absorption from food declines. Fortified cereals, supplements, and animal products are key.
- Fiber: Helps combat common age-related issues like constipation by promoting healthy digestion.
- Potassium and Magnesium: Important for blood pressure regulation and overall cellular function.
- Omega-3 Fatty Acids: Support brain and heart health and can be found in fatty fish like salmon.
The Importance of Hydration
With a reduced thirst sensation, older adults must be mindful of their fluid intake. Staying well-hydrated is critical for kidney function, nutrient transport, and overall bodily processes. In addition to water, soups, fruits, and vegetables can contribute significantly to daily fluid intake.
Comparison of Nutritional Needs: Young Adult vs. Older Adult
| Aspect | Young Adult (approx. 20s-30s) | Older Adult (60+) |
|---|---|---|
| Energy Needs | Higher caloric intake due to a higher BMR and often greater physical activity. | Lower caloric intake due to decreased metabolism and reduced muscle mass. |
| Nutrient Density | Can tolerate less nutrient-dense foods if overall balance is met. | Must prioritize nutrient-dense foods to get sufficient vitamins and minerals from fewer calories. |
| Protein | Adequate protein intake to support muscle growth and repair. | Higher protein requirements per kilogram of body weight to combat age-related muscle loss (sarcopenia). |
| Vitamin B12 | Readily absorbed from food sources. | Reduced absorption due to lower stomach acid; fortified foods or supplements are often necessary. |
| Calcium & Vitamin D | Needs are typically met through a balanced diet and sun exposure. | Increased need for calcium and vitamin D to maintain bone density and prevent osteoporosis. |
| Fiber | Important for general digestive health. | Particularly crucial to combat slower gut motility and constipation common with age. |
| Fluid Intake | Thirst mechanism is typically robust, encouraging adequate intake. | Thirst sensation often decreases, requiring conscious effort to stay hydrated. |
Strategies for Healthy Aging
Meeting changing nutritional needs requires a proactive approach. Making small, consistent changes over time can have a major impact on long-term health.
- Focus on Whole Foods: Prioritize minimally processed foods like fruits, vegetables, whole grains, lean proteins, and healthy fats.
- Meal Planning: Plan meals to ensure nutrient density. Using herbs and spices can enhance flavor to compensate for a dulled sense of taste, without adding excess salt or sugar.
- Small, Frequent Meals: For those with reduced appetite, eating smaller meals throughout the day can help ensure adequate nutrient and calorie intake.
- Consider Supplements: Consult a healthcare provider or registered dietitian to determine if supplements for vitamins like B12, D, or calcium are appropriate.
- Stay Active: Regular physical activity, particularly resistance exercise, is vital for maintaining muscle mass and can help stimulate appetite.
